St Nicholas (gross tonnage 787)
St Nicholas, an iron screw steamer, was built in Whiteinch 1871, was on various North runs from that year, pioneering the direct Aberdeen/Lerwick route in 1891. She grounded off Wick on 17th June 1914 and became a total loss, breaking her back as the tide ebbed.
